Former Kentucky guard Kerr Kriisa arrested by FBI; extradition to West Virginia planned

Former NCAA basketball star Kerr Kriisa has been arrested by the FBI in connection with an alleged multimillion-dollar fraud scheme.

Kerr Kriisa, a former guard for Kentucky, West Virginia, and the Arizona Wildcats, was arrested by the FBI. The arrest is linked to an alleged multimillion-dollar fraud scam.

Coverage from Reuters, the New York Post, On3, and azcentral.com emphasizes the scale of the alleged fraud and Kriisa's athletic history across multiple universities. WKYT reports that extradition to West Virginia is planned.

Future developments center on the extradition process to West Virginia and the specifics of the fraud allegations.
